The table below provides summary statistics for contract job vacancies advertised in the South West requiring knowledge or experience of Oracle products and/or services. It includes a benchmarking guide to contractor rates offered in vacancies that cited Oracle over the 6 months leading up to 21 November 2025, comparing them to the same period in the previous two years.

The figures below represent the IT contractor job market in general and are not representative of contractor rates within the Oracle Corporation.

6 months to
21 Nov 2025
Same period 2024 Same period 2023
Rank 29 46 51
Rank change year-on-year +17 +5 +2
Contract jobs citing Oracle 135 100 121
As % of all contract jobs in the South West 6.03% 4.17% 3.89%
As % of the Vendors category 13.96% 9.15% 9.31%
Number of daily rates quoted 80 66 85
10th Percentile - £400 £400
25th Percentile £450 £426 £488
Median daily rate (50th Percentile) £475 £550 £575
Median % change year-on-year -13.64% -4.35% +9.52%
75th Percentile £575 £688 £675
90th Percentile £675 £738 £720
England median daily rate £515 £550 £550
% change year-on-year -6.36% - -
